Nestled amongst the trees, just off Beaver Ruin Road, the Darnell offers sophistication and elegance like no other. The Darnell welcomes residents with a beautiful and abundant amenity package as well as one-, two-, and three-bedroom apartment homes featuring stainless steel appliances, granite countertops, and Jackson EMC Right Choice Energy Efficiency–rated interiors. The community is complemented by an exceptional amenity offering, including a swimming pool with spacious sunbathing areas and a well-appointed fitness center with cardio and strength training equipment.     If you’re looking for a clean, quiet, and peaceful place to live, this is not the community for you. There are dogs barking constantly throughout the day and well into the night. I’ve been woken up on multiple occasions by dogs barking because residents leave them out on their patios for extended periods of time, where they bark at anyone or anything that walks by. It’s incredibly disruptive and makes it difficult to relax or enjoy being at home. Loud music plays at all hours, kids are constantly yelling and running through the property, and residents frequently speed through the neighborhood, creating an unsafe environment. If you’re paying this much in rent, you expect to come home to peace and quiet, but that simply isn’t the reality here. The walls are paper-thin. I’ve heard neighbors yelling, arguing, and even having sex on multiple occasions. It’s incredibly uncomfortable, disrespectful, and not something anyone should have to listen to in their own home. The hallways and breezeways are filthy. There are cobwebs, bugs everywhere, and the breezeways constantly smell like marijuana. On top of that, there are now roaches. Trash is scattered throughout the property, and the valet trash service regularly drags garbage through the hallways, leaving leaking liquids behind. It’s unsanitary and creates terrible odors. The dog park is full of dog waste that isn’t cleaned up, and it smells awful. To make matters worse, the community grills are located right next to the dog park, so you’re trying to cook while surrounded by the smell of dog waste. The office advertises nice amenities, but they are rarely maintained. The coffee machine is often out of service, and when it does work, there are usually no cups, coffee, sugar, or creamer available. The pool is supposed to close at 9:00 p.m., but there are regularly large groups of people there well after closing time, playing loud music. Many of them don’t even appear to be residents. The gym is also consistently overcrowded with people who don’t seem to live in the community. One of the biggest issues is the lack of consistent management. I haven’t even lived here for a full year, and I’ve already seen three different office teams. Despite all the rules and notices that management sends out, they don’t seem to enforce the rules that actually matter. They are quick to issue policies, but they don’t ensure the community is peaceful, clean, safe, or properly maintained. The overall quality of this community has declined dramatically. For the amount of money residents pay to live here, it should be much cleaner, quieter, and better managed. Instead, it’s become a noisy, disruptive place to live where basic standards of cleanliness and quality of life are ignored. The amenities may look appealing during a tour, but the day-to-day living experience has been extremely disappointing. If you’re looking for a peaceful place to call home, I honestly cannot recommend this community.

    I lived there for a year and a half. I moved out and It’s been a month since I’ve been requesting a refund for my deposit. I understand there’s a process involved, but every time I call, they consistently say, “I’ll get it next week.” Very disappointing. Update: I went to pick up my deposit refund, but they were deducting money for “damages” I didn’t cause. Normal wear and tear on carpet shouldn’t be charged, and extra charges for “cleaning” shouldn’t be either. Since they lacked proof for the “damages” because the pictures they had didn’t show anything. I spoke to the manager’s assistant, and he agreed to get my money back for the carpet charges at least. For anyone with a contract here, be careful when they return your deposit. Take pictures before leaving to avoid unexpected charges for things you didn’t damage. Overall this property was good to live in.
